Ordinals
beta
Sat 1983845842312401
decimal
888306.217312401
degree
0°48306′1266″217312401‴
percentile
94.46884973783963%
name
ujeswloema
cycle
0
epoch
4
period
440
block
888306
offset
217312401
timestamp
2025-03-18 08:02:17 UTC
rarity
common
prev
next